Tobramycin Inhalation Powder (TIP) in Cystic Fibrosis Patients Infected With Burkholderia Cepacia Complex

The objective of this study is to determine if tobramycin inhalation powder (TIP) can reduce the amount of Burkholderia Cepacia Complex (BCC) species - type of bacteria, in the sputum of cystic fibrosis patient.

Who can participate

Healthy volunteers accepted: No

Only the study team can determine whether someone qualifies for participation.

Inclusion criteria

  • Age 6 years or older
  • Diagnosis of CF based on the following: sweat chloride>60 mEq/L or genotype with 2 identifiable mutations consistent with CF; and one or more clinical features consistent with CF.
  • Chronically infected with a Burkholderia cepacia complex species (>50% of respiratory specimens positive in the 24 months prior to screening).
  • Able to produce sputum (expectorated or induced).
  • Able to reproducibly perform pulmonary function testing.
  • Written informed consent provided.

Exclusion criteria

  • Post lung transplantation.
  • Pregnancy.
  • Acute exacerbation requiring IV or oral antibiotics within 14 days
  • Patients currently receiving inhaled tobramycin/TOBI
  • A septic or clinically unstable patient, as determined by the investigator.

Treatment and study plan

TOBI

Drug

New inhalation devices such as the podhaler can administer tobramycin inhalation powder TIP/TOBI and achieve very high sputum drug levels. TOBI will be administered using the Podhaler

Primary outcomes

  1. The Change in Sputum Density of BCC in Colony Forming Units (CFUs)/ml From Day 0 to Day 28 of TIP Treatment.

    Time frame: 0 to 28 days

    The change in sputum density of BCC in colony forming units (CFUs)/ml from day 0 to day 28 of TIP treatment. Sputum density was calculated by doing serial dilutions of sputum on agar plates and counting colony forming units expressed per ml.

Secondary outcomes

  1. The Change in Pulmonary Function Tests, Including Forced Expiratory Volume in 1 Second (FEV1), Forced Vital Capacity (FVC) and Maximal Mid-expiratory Flow Rate (FEF25-75), Measured at Day 0 and Day 28 of TIP Treatment.

    Time frame: 0 to 28 days

    The main lung function measure was relative change in FEV1 from day 0 to Day 28 reported as %.
